Crock Pot Chicken and Stuffing with Green Beans Recipe

  • Total Time: 7 hours 10 minutes
  • Yield: 6 1x

Ingredients

Main Protein:

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(1 kg / 2 lbs)

Stuffing and Vegetable Components:

  • 1 box stuffing mix (170 g / 6 oz)
  • 2 cups fresh or frozen green beans (or 1 can, drained)

Sauce and Seasoning Components:

  • 1 can cream of chicken soup (300 g / 10.5 oz)
  • 1 cup chicken broth
  • ½ cup sour cream
  • 1 tablespoon butter, cut into small pieces
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me (optional)
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

  1. Coat the interior of the slow cooker with a light layer of nonstick spray to prevent sticking and ensure easy cleanup.
  2. Arrange chicken breasts in a single layer across the bottom of the appliance, evenly distributing them to promote uniform cooking.
  3. Generously season the chicken with a blend of gar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and black pepper to enhance the overall flavor profile.
  4. Distribute fresh green beans in an even layer directly over the seasoned chicken, creating a colorful and nutritious base.
  5. Create a creamy sauce by whisking together cream of chicken soup, sour cream, and chicken broth until smooth and well-combined.
  6. Carefully pour the prepared sauce over the green beans and chicken, ensuring complete coverage and moisture throughout the dish.
  7. Sprinkle the dry stuffing mix uniformly across the top of the sauce, creating a golden, crispy layer that will absorb the surrounding flavors.
  8. Optional: Drizzle melted butter over the stuffing to enhance browning and add richness to the final texture.
  9. Secure the slow cooker lid and allow the meal to simmer on low heat for 6-7 hours or on high heat for 3-4 hours until the chicken is thoroughly cooked and tender.
  10. Once cooking is complete, gently fold the stuffing into the sauce, creating a cohesive and inviting one-pot meal.
  11. Serve immediately while hot, ensuring each portion contains a perfect blend of chicken, vegetables, and seasoned stuffing.

Notes

  • Swap chicken breasts for chicken thighs for richer flavor and more tender meat.
  • Replace cream of chicken soup with a homemade version or low-sodium alternative for healthier option.
  • Use gluten-free stuffing mix and cream of chicken soup to make the recipe celiac-friendly.
  • Enhance protein content by adding extra diced chicken or turkey for more substantial meal.
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 6-7 hours (low) or 3-4 hours (high)
  • Category: Dinner
  • Method: Slow Cooking
  • Cuisine: American
